8.NS
8.NS.1 The student will compare and order real numbers and determine the relationships between real numbers.
8.NS.2 The student will investigate and describe the relationship between the subsets of the real number system.
8.CE
8.CE.1 The student will estimate and apply proportional reasoning and computational procedures to solve contextual problems.
8.MG
8.MG.1 The student will use the relationships among pairs of angles that are vertical angles, adjacent angles, supplementary angles, and complementary angles to determine the measure of unknown angles.
8.MG.2 The student will investigate and determine the surface area of square-based pyramids and the volume of cones and square-based pyramids.
8.MG.3 The student will apply translations and reflections to polygons in the coordinate plane.
8.MG.4 The student will apply the Pythagorean Theorem to solve problems involving right triangles, including those in context.
8.MG.5 The student will solve area and perimeter problems involving composite plane figures, including those in context.
8.PS
8.PS.1 The student will use statistical investigation to determine the probability of independent and dependent events, including those in context.
8.PS.2 The student will apply the data cycle (formulate questions; collect or acquire data; organize and represent data; and analyze data and communicate results) with a focus on boxplots.
8.PS.3 The student will apply the data cycle (formulate questions; collect or acquire data; organize and represent data; and analyze data and communicate results) with a focus on scatterplots.
8.PFA
8.PFA.1 The student will represent, simplify, and generate equivalent algebraic expressions in one variable.
8.PFA.2 The student will determine whether a given relation is a function and determine the domain and range of a function.
8.PFA.3 The student will represent and solve problems, including those in context, by using linear functions and analyzing their key characteristics (the value of the y-intercept (b) and the coordinates of the ordered pairs in graphs will be limited to integers).
8.PFA.4 The student will write and solve multistep linear equations in one variable, including problems in context that require the solution of a multistep linear equation in one variable.
8.PFA.5 The student will write and solve multistep linear inequalities in one variable, including problems in context that require the solution of a multistep linear inequality in one variable.
